ASML Raises Full-Year Outlook Again Amid AI Chip Demand Surge

Equipment maker ASML boosted its annual sales guidance for the second time as chip manufacturers accelerate AI production capacity.

According to CNBC, semiconductor equipment manufacturer ASML announced a second guidance increase for the year, reflecting robust demand from its customer base expanding artificial intelligence chip manufacturing capabilities. The Dutch company's decision to raise expectations underscores the sustained strength in the AI sector and confidence in sustained customer demand through the remainder of the year.

The repeated forecast adjustments highlight how semiconductor manufacturers are aggressively scaling production facilities to meet soaring demand for AI-capable processors. ASML's guidance raises signal that equipment suppliers see sustained momentum in capital spending from chipmakers investing in the infrastructure needed to produce next-generation AI semiconductors.

ASML's back-to-back guidance improvements position the company as a key beneficiary of the AI infrastructure expansion taking place across the semiconductor industry. As a leading provider of advanced chip-making equipment, ASML's strengthened outlook reflects the critical role such suppliers play in enabling chipmakers to meet accelerating AI computational demands.
